Abstract

In trials near Delhi, sorghum cv. Swarna and CSH-1 were sown on 5 dates at 7-day intervals beginning 26 June. Average grain yields decreased linearly from 44 hkg/ha for the 1st sowing to 19.4 hkg/ha for the final sowing. The decrease in yield was estimated to be 52.3, 70.8, 105.7 and 123 kg grain/ha per day respectively for each successive sowing made after 26 June.-M.S.M.
